Medieval Iron Well Bucket, also referred to as cooking pot or witches cauldron. In the history of Europe, the Middle Ages or Medieval period lasted from the 5th to the 15th century. It began with the fall of the Western Roman Empire and merged into the Renaissance and the Age of Discovery. The Middle Ages is the middle period of the three traditional divisions of Western history: classical antiquity, the medieval period, and the modern period. The medieval period is itself subdivided into the Early, High, and Late Middle Ages. Condition Report: The iron metal is fragile and can flake off over time. Estimated more than 500 yrs old.
